The benefits of 03 phone numbers
030 phone numbers are exclusively for public bodies and charities to use and offer exactly the same benefits as other non-geographic telephone numbers (e.g. 0800 numbers or 0845 numbers).
There is also a range of 03 numbers that any organisations can use: 033 numbers.
Here’s 10 benefits of using an 03 number:
1) They cost people the same to call as standard landline numbers (01/02 numbers) - even from a mobile phone.
2) They are included in the free minutes allocations offered by all landline and mobile tariffs.
3) They work alongside any landline or mobile number and this can be changed instantly at anytime. This enables people to take calls wherever they are.
4) Online call statistics work in conjunction with 03 phone numbers which enables people to find out how many calls they have recieved, how many they have missed and when their busy periods are. This helps organisations make smarter decisions about their marketing and plan their staffing levels effectively.
5) They are perfect for disaster recovery. For example, if your landline fails or in the event of an office evacuation you can simply divert calls to an alternative mobile/landline number instantly.
6) Organisations can handpick a telephone number that their callers will remember easily - e.g. 0333 123 4567.
7) Callers can be queued so all important calls will be answered.

9) Callers can hear an audio message when they phone an 03 number - e.g. “Thanks for calling XYZ”. This ensures that people know they have dialled the correct number and many smaller companies use this to portray a bigger and established image.
10) They are future proof. In 2010 more UK calls will be made from landlines than mobiles. Because 03 numbers are the most cost effective phone numbers for mobile users - this ensures that organisations that use them will encourage more calls.
03 numbers are becoming more and more popular by the day. Many UK organisations are now using them including the BBC, National Blood Service, Capital Radio, Comic Relief and numerous small businesses. This is likely to be because they offer all the benefits of 08 numbers whilst giving callers exceptional value. This also means they are not subject to negative publicity as they are trusted and ethical telephone numbers.
